Title: The Great Circus 2000 - Memoirs of an FFL fighter pilot in the RAF - Pierre Clostermann - book
Summary :
The Great Circus 2000 is the memoir of a young pilot in the Free French Air Force seconded to the Royal Air Force squadrons. Never before have the fury of aerial dogfights, the agony in the flames, and the anti-aircraft batteries been so vividly described. These texts, written day by day, place the reader in the cockpit of a fighter plane, always, hundreds of mornings later, with the underlying anxiety of wondering if this day will be the last. Published worldwide, a landmark book that William Faulkner would call "the only great book to come out of the Second World War," this true text is also a profoundly human testimony to the unsuspected virtues often revealed by war. This edition includes the author's complete journal and manuscripts written between 1941 and 1945. Two hundred previously unpublished pages and a significant collection of illustrations complete this 1948 bestseller.
